Build ReDroid with docker
Sync Code
ReDroid manifest include several branches:
redroid12-gsi,redroid-s-beta-3redroid11-gsi,redroid-11.0.0redroid10-gsi,redroid-10.0.0redroid-9.0.0,redroid9-gsi(experimental)redroid-8.1.0
branch with -gsi is recommended (fully treble / VNDK enforced).
# fetch code
mkdir aosp && cd aosp
repo init -u https://github.com/remote-android/platform_manifests.git -b <BRANCH> --depth=1
repo sync -c --no-tags
Build
# create builder docker image
# adjust apt.conf and source.list if needed
docker build --build-arg userid=$(id -u) --build-arg groupid=$(id -g) --build-arg username=$(id -un) -t android-build-trusty .
# *inside* builder container
cd /src
. build/envsetup.sh
lunch redroid_x86_64-userdebug
# or lunch redroid_arm64-userdebug
m
# create redroid docker image in *HOST*
cd <BUILD-OUT-DIR>
sudo mount system.img system -o ro
sudo mount vendor.img vendor -o ro
sudo tar --xattrs -c vendor -C system --exclude="vendor" . | docker import -c 'ENTRYPOINT ["/init", "qemu=1", "androidboot.hardware=redroid"]' - redroid
